Saginaw Valley State University offers 104 programs through Bachelor's, Master's, Doctorate, and Post Graduate Certificate. By degree types, it offers 72 Bachelor's, 29 Master's, 1 Doctorate (professional), 2 Post-MS Certificate programs.
It also offers its programs via online learning and 2 programs are available through Bachelor's, Master's, Doctorate and Post Graduate Certificate. By degree types, it offers 2 Master's program in the virtual environment.
For the academic year 2022-2023, total 1,555 students have completed their degree/programs and graduated from Saginaw Valley State University.
The following table summarizes the offered degrees and programs with number of programs and number of completers.
By degrees/certificates, 1,265 Bachelor's, 279 Master's, 4 Doctorate (professional), and 7 Post-MS Certificate were awareded by Saginaw Valley State.
